Zildjian LIVE! Season 2, Episode 3: Marcus Gilmore
“Southern Spirits” Written by: Robert Sput Searight
Performed by: Marcus Gilmore and Ghost-Note
Zildjian LIVE Season 2 represents the energy and passion that’s generated when you bring together artists from around the world for a true Zildjian Family Experience!
Season 2 is hosted by Aaron Spears, musically directed by Robert “Sput” Searight and features the band Ghost-Note!
Marcus' Cymbal Setup:
10” Prototype Dry Zil Bel HiHats
16” Prototype K Sweet HiHats w/Clusters and Tambourine Jingles
20” K Constantinople with Rivets
21” K Custom Special Dry Ride
17” K Constantinople Crash
14 ¼” K Custom Hybrid HiHats
